Web24 apr. 2024 · This way you can have mushrooms continually. A typical 3 foot log should produce 2-3 lbs. of mushrooms every fruiting, or 1 pound per linear foot. Log Life A log … Web4 apr. 2024 · With a cord of oak which weighs 2,200-pounds and contains 300 logs and an average yield of 7%, one could expect to grow154 pounds of shiitake over 3 growing seasons. At $4 per pound, this cord would gross $616 over three years. These are conservative estimates based upon the Minnesota experience.
